- •1. Представление пространственных данных в гис
- •1.1. Гис как взгляд на окружающий мир
- •1.2. Основные типы представления географических сущностей
- •1.3. Организация атрибутных данных в гис
- •1.4. Представление отношений в гис
- •1.5. Резюме
- •2. Сущности, объекты и аттрибуты гис
- •2.1. Введение
- •2.2. Пространственные и непространственные данные
- •2.3. Элементарные, составные и сложные объекты
- •2.3. Точечные данные
- •Колодцы
- •2.4. Линейные данные
- •2.5. Площадные данные
- •2.6. Непрерывные поверхности
- •2.7. Резюме
- •3. Концепция векторных гис
- •3.1. Векторная модель данных
- •3.2. Топологические отношения
- •3.3. Построение топологии
- •3.4. Отображение векторных данных и запросы
- •3.5. Переклассификация объектов
- •3.6. Резюме
- •4. Пространственный анализ в векторных гис
- •4.1. Введение
- •4.2. Наложение слоев
- •5. Концепция растровых гис
- •5.1. Модель данных растровых гис
- •5.2. Характеристики растровых слоев
- •5.3. Выборка значений ячейки и топология растровой модели
- •5.4. Растровые слои
- •5.5. Дискретные растры
- •1.6. Представление непрерывных поверхностей
- •5.7. Практическое использование растровых данных
- •5.8. Резюме
- •6. Пространственный анализ в растровых гис
- •6.1. Введение
- •6.2. Описание характеристик растра
- •6.3. Локальные операции
- •6.2. Оверлеи растров
- •6.4. Фокальные операции
- •6.5. Зональные операции
- •6.6. Резюме
- •Литература
1.4. Представление отношений в гис
ГИС предоставляют пользователю эффективные механизмы для хранения местоположения географических сущностей и их атрибутов, но кроме этого во многих задачах требуется проследить отношения между географическими объектами.
Между объектами в модели пространственно-распределенных данных могут существовать пространственные отношения: расстояние между объектами, близость, соседство, двоичные отношения "находится внутри", "находится снаружи", "пересекаются" и т.д.
Отношения между объектами могут также быть построены на основе метрической информации об объектах. Например, язык создания приложений ГИС MapInfo позволяет выяснить взаимное расположение объектов в пространстве при помощи специальных географических операторов.
Рис. 1. Географические операторы языка MapBasic
Таблица 1.
Географические операторы языка MapBasic
Оператор |
Описание оператора |
A Contains B |
Объект A содержит центроид объекта B |
A Contains Part B |
Объект A содержит часть объекта B |
A Contains Entire B |
Объект A содержит весь объект B |
A Within B |
Центроид объекта A лежит внутри B |
A Partly Within B |
Часть объекта A лежит внутри B |
A Entirely Within B |
Объект A полностью лежит внутри B |
A Intersects B |
A и B пересекаются хотя бы в одной точке |
1.5. Резюме
Информация о географических сущностях представлена в виде пространственных объектов, с которыми связаны атрибутные данные.
Модель данных задает правила структурирования пространственных объектов и их непространственных атрибутов.
Есть два основных вида моделей пространственных данных – векторная и растровая. Выбор модели данных зависит от требований проекта.
Как векторная, так и растровая модели имеют присоединенные атрибутные данные, обрабатываемые как «плоские» файлы, иерархические, сетевые и реляционные базы данных.
Топология также определяет структуру пространственных данных и является основой для кодирования взаимосвязей между объектами в ГИС.
Контрольные вопросы и задания
Каким образом в геоинформационных системах может быть представлена информация о географических сущностях?
Опишите в общих чертах различия, преимущества и недостатки векторной и растровой моделей географических данных.
Расскажите о способах обработки межобъектных отношений в ГИС.
2. Сущности, объекты и аттрибуты гис
Цели занятия:
Изучить базовые концепции представления окружающей реальности в виде пространственно-распределенных данных.
Понять природу пространственных и атрибутных данных.
Рассмотреть объекты, используемые для представления географических сущностей.
2.1. Введение
Окружающий нас мир слишком сложен для нашего непосредственного понимания.
Мы создаем модели реальности, имеющие в некоторых аспектах общие свойства с исследуемыми сущностями реального мира. На основе этих моделей создаются базы данных.
Моделирование является одним из наиболее распространенных в науке понятий. Первоначально под словом “модель” подразумевался “образец в малом виде”, уменьшенная копия предмета. Впоследствии моделями стали называть любые образы (изображения, описания, схемы, карты и т.д.) объектов, процессов, явлений, используемые в качестве “заместителя”, “представителя”, оригинала данной модели. [1]
Сущности реального мира в пространственно – распределенных базах данных представлены пространственными объектами, с которыми связаны атрибутные данные.
Современные геоинформационные системы представляют пространственное распределение сущностей в виде объектов: точек, линий, ломаных, путей, площадей, поверхностей. Атрибуты содержат пространственную и непространственную информацию о сущностях и связаны с пространственными объектами ГИС.
Рис. 2. Модель данных геоинформационных систем
Определение.
Атрибут (attribute) - свойство, качественный или количественный признак, характеризующий пространственный объект (но не связанный с его местоуказанием) и ассоциированный с его уникальным номером, или идентификатором; наборы значений атрибутов (attribute value) обычно представляются в форме таблиц средствами реляционных СУБД; классу атрибута (attribute class) при этом соответствует имя колонки, или столбца (column) или поля таблицы (field). Для упорядочения, хранения и манипулирования атрибутивными данными (attribute data) используются средства систем управления базами данных, как правило, реляционного типа.
